Placerville, CA—The Miss El Dorado County Scholarship Pageant 2024 unfolded with grace and excitement on June 13, 2024, as part of the El Dorado County Fair. This annual event is a platform where young women shine, vying for titles across multiple age divisions: Junior Miss, Miss, and Teen. Through various categories such as panel interviews, fair wear, and formal wear, these young contestants showcased their confidence, style, and poise, all while expressing their unique personalities and talents.

A Night of Glamour and Grace

The competition was fierce yet friendly, with each contestant bringing her best to the stage. The event also included special awards, which added an extra layer of anticipation and excitement. The People’s Choice Award, determined by community votes, saw significant participation, raising over $5,800 to support scholarships for the winners.

Celebrating Excellence and Spirit

The Director’s Choice Award, a highlight of the evening, was presented to Kylie. This accolade is voted on by the staff and honors the contestant who best exemplified the spirit of the pageant. Kylie was recognized for her kindness, dedication, and the positive impact she had on her fellow contestants, making the pageant a memorable experience for all involved.

Community and Camaraderie

In addition to Kylie’s recognition, the coveted Miss Congeniality title, which celebrates supportiveness and encouragement among contestants, also went to Kylie. Her peers acknowledged her unwavering support and camaraderie throughout the competition, underscoring the spirit of friendship and mutual respect that defines the pageant.

People’s Choice and Community Support

Morgan Williamson emerged victorious as the Junior Miss People’s Choice Award winner, having garnered 1,472 votes. The community’s enthusiastic participation in the voting process highlighted the strong local support for the event and its contestants.

And the Winners Are…

The culmination of the evening saw the crowning of new titleholders who will represent El Dorado County with pride and grace. The titles were awarded as follows:

  • Junior Miss El Dorado County 2024: Morgan Williamson
  • Miss Teen El Dorado County 2024: Elanor
  • Miss El Dorado County 2024: Elizabeth

Each winner stepped into her new role with excitement and a commitment to serving as a positive role model within the community.
